ISLAMABAD: Federal Finance Minister Senator Ishaq Dar will formally launch the Economic Survey 2016-17 on Thursday (today). According to a statement, he will share the key economic indicators and the performance of different sectors of the economy with the media. He will also provide an overview of the economic progress made in recent years in Pakistan. He will highlight the main features of the comprehensive reforms agenda undertaken by the present government, which has resulted in macro-economic stability and a ten-year high growth rate of 5.28 percent. On Friday, the finance minister will present the budget for Fiscal Year (FY) 2017-2018 on the floor of the National Assembly. In his budget speech, he will provide details of the revenue, expenditure and relief measures envisaged for the next fiscal year.
